Originally broadcast 1935-1955.
Summary
Presents excerpts from radio broadcasts of the program, America's town meeting of the air, in commemoration of its twentieth anniversary. Includes critical debate and discussion of domestic and international issues by various public figures.

Contents
The struggle between government and business : Robert H. Jackson and Wendell Wilkie
The New Deal : Harold L. Ickes and General Hugh S. Johnson
How free a press? : Harold L. Ickes and publisher Frank E. Gannett
Negotiate with Russia? : Jan Masaryk
Intervention in Europe : Dean Acheson and Verne Marshall
Lend-lease for Britain : Norman Thomas and Wendell Wilkie
A fourth term for F.D.R. : John Sparkman and Edward R. Burke
The United Nations, promise and performance : Senator Tom Connally, Raymond Swing, H.V. Kaltenborn, Trygve Lie, and Adlai E. Stevenson
Hunger in the world : Fiorello LaGuardia
Democracy's mission in Asia : Prime Minister Jawaharlal Nehru
The Far East, war and communism : Senator William F. Knowland, Richard M. Nixon, Senator John Sparkman, Dr. You Chan Yang, and Thomas E. Dewey
The welfare state : Oscar L. Chapman and Senator Robert A. Taft
Should the communist party be outlawed? : Senator Joseph R. McCarthy and Governor Ellis Arnall
The Army-McCarthy hearings : Godfrey P. Schmidt and Norman Thomas
Equal rights : Walter White
Juvenile delinquency : Father Edward J. Flanagan
The comics : John Mason Brown and Al Capp
Peace of mind and man : Arnold J. Toynbee, Billy Graham, and Rabbi Joshua Loth Liebmann.
